Alcohol ingestion induces pancreatic islet dysfunction and apoptosis via mediation of FGF21 resistance

Long-term ethanol consumption induces FGF21 resistance-mediated pancreatic β-cell dysfunction, and thus diabetes pathogenesis risk.
